Output ef85c4d2ec52143f185a5fd43c3f43d1f49be35ac7b7b0bf9839904d7fb5763c:1

value
2941176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21cdf5ff820fb18b923eb3e2b662ad23263eca8 OP_EQUAL
address
3Hvnnnn52SnBdBzAARtfhUAeBJfRhVDEqh
transaction
ef85c4d2ec52143f185a5fd43c3f43d1f49be35ac7b7b0bf9839904d7fb5763c
confirmations
159707
spent
true